GCVCC Supports SB 657 (Ochoa Bogh)

March 25, 2021

News from the GCVCC Business Legislative Advocacy Committee:

Letter of Support:

The California Chamber of Commerce and the organizations listed above are pleased to SUPPORT SB
657 (Ochoa Bogh). SB 657 will make it easier for telecommuting employees to receive required notices
from their employer.

During the current COVID-19 crisis, many employers have considered offering employees the opportunity
to work from home in the midst of shelter-in-place and stay-at-home orders. Where such telecommuting is
possible, it allows employees to remain working and earning income, even during a pandemic or other
disruption. With near-record unemployment, we should be doing everything possible to maximize
opportunities for employers to allow telecommuting so that workers can continue to be employed and
support themselves and their families.

These changes will be necessary even beyond the current pandemic. A recent survey of employers
indicated that 52% will be offering telecommuting until the pandemic subsides, and 30% plan to allow
employees to work remotely on an ongoing basis.
